NCERT · Class 10 · Mathematics · Quadratic EquationsThe product of the roots of the quadratic equation $3x^2 + 11x - 4 = 0$ is:
Step-by-Step Solution
Product of roots $= \frac{c}{a}$.\nHere $a = 3, b = 11, c = -4$. Product of roots $= \frac{-4}{3} = -\frac{4}{3}$.
